​👀​ Did You Know ? 🤯 Fun facts about Before Stonewall (1984)
  • Greta Schiller dropped this as her first feature film, turning a book on NYC gay life into full-blown Gay History 101. Bow down to the newbie who schooled the world!
  • Co-directed by Robert Rosenberg, executive produced by John Scagliotti. Debuted at Toronto Film Fest 1984, limited release 1985, then PBS 1986 as the network's first lesbian-funded broadcast. Queer milestone alert!
  • Rita Mae Brown, Rubyfruit Jungle queen, narrates with zero filter. Elderly survivors spill WWII closet tea: loves in barracks, McCarthy dodges. Real talk from the trenches!
  • 50th Stonewall anniv restore scanned original 16mm at Periscope Films. Now crisper than your ex's excuses. Re-premiered Quad Cinema 2019 with Schiller and Jezebel Productions buzz!
  • Pries open 1900-1969: Roaring 20s subculture, Depression balls, military queers. Hollywood nods like 1932's Call Her Savage with Clara Bow's queer wink. Pre-riot party footage slays!
  • AIDS era drop (1984) made it urgent: bar patrons turned revolutionaries dying off. Time capsule that fueled activism. TIME revisited for Stonewall 50th as sea-change spark!
  • First Run Features pushed re-release; Horseshead.blog calls it queer activism origin. Packed Toronto fest, now cult re-watch. Buzz eternal!
